About Ecce virgo concipiet
Cristóbal de Morales sets the prophecy of Isaiah that a virgin shall conceive and bear a son, Emmanuel, God with us. The Hebrew text, transliterated into the score, gives way to a Latin setting of the same words, highlighting Morales's mastery of polyphony within the sacred motet tradition. This SATB setting unfolds with a rich, imitative texture, drawing the listener into the profound mystery of the Incarnation. Morales's sensitive word-setting ensures that the gravitas and hope of the prophecy are powerfully conveyed. The motet's solemnity and devotional character make it a fitting choice for liturgical settings or thoughtful choral programming.
